A BPM software to answer your business needs
Updated March 11, 2024

A BPM software to answer your business needs

Anonymous | TrustRadius Reviewer
Score 8 out of 10
Vetted Review
Verified User

Modules Used

  • Bonita Enterprise Edition

Overall Satisfaction with Bonita Platform

We developed a solution based on the Bonita Platform to allow users to
subscribe to services and automate the validation of those
subscriptions. The workflow controls the eligibility of the user to
subscribe, call multiple micro-services, and respond with the list of
services available. If anything fails, depending on the type of error,
the main workflow is automatically retried using an error handling
workflow or ended with the detailed error saved.


  • Automation of the steps in the workflow
  • Configuration allows the workflow to be independent of the environment in which it is deployed
  • The detailed case for the users to follow and manage the status and the synthesis of the case


  • Easier and more opened integration in K8s environment
  • Missing debugging mode during development phase
  • Bonita Platform has simplified a business process by automating it, so it could be easier for the user and the admin

Do you think Bonita Platform delivers good value for the price?


Are you happy with Bonita Platform's feature set?


Did Bonita Platform live up to sales and marketing promises?


Did implementation of Bonita Platform go as expected?


Would you buy Bonita Platform again?


It is pretty simple to duplicate a process to implement a different use case. The feature for saving a connector configuration is also great as it saves time for the developer to use it on another step of the process for example.
The development phase has not been easy because you can't use breakpoints to debug. But you can use loggers to trace information about the manipulated data so the debugging is hard, but not impossible. The integration to a cloud-based environment was not easy because we had some requirements that weren't available at the time. But the support helped us weel providing us with a new feature to answer our needs.
In our use case, Bonita was well-suited enough. But there as been some difficulties to implement a cron-based process to clean up or retry the cases in error state or not updated for a long time for example. I can't say how the product will be suited for a more complex use case, but I'm sure that the support of Bonitasoft will help a lot, as has been the case for us.

Bonita Platform Feature Ratings

Process designer
Business rules engine
SOA support
Not Rated
Support for modeling languages
Form builder
Not Rated
Model execution
Not Rated
Social collaboration tools
Not Rated
Not Rated
Standard reports
Not Rated
Custom reports
Not Rated
Content management
Not Rated


More Reviews of Bonita Platform